Select a board that will fit in the rod pocket in the back of the tapestry.
The procedure for hanging the tapestry involves securing the wood to the wall with the top of the tapestry sandwiched between it and the wall.

Weighty textiles and tapestries may need more support and a baseboard will help secure the piece to the wall.
You can also try sliding a rod with finials which looks similar to a curtain rod through the pocket and place the rod on wall mounted brackets.

The tapestry should be straight which means you need to level the wood before attaching it and the screws should be secure which means driving them into studs or wall anchors.
